How is volcanic island arc formed?

How is volcanic island arc formed?

oceanic arcs form when oceanic crust subducts beneath other oceanic crust on an adjacent plate, creating a volcanic island arc. (Not all island arcs are volcanic island arcs.) continental arcs form when oceanic crust subducts beneath continental crust on an adjacent plate, creating an arc-shaped mountain belt.

Where do island volcanic arcs form?

Island arcs form on the crest of curved crustal ridges bounded on one side by deep oceanic trenches. The trenches form as the subducting oceanic plate is bent downward and plunges beneath the overriding plate. Island arcs are volcanic islands that form parallel to ocean trenches in subduction zones.

How are island arcs formed simple?

Islands form an arc when two oceanic plates converge creating a row of islands above the overriding plate. The older plate, which is heavier and denser, is forced beneath the lighter plate. The subducting plate begins to heat up as it descends into the lithosphere and eventually melts .

What is volcanic arc?

A volcanic arc is a chain of volcanoes, hundreds to thousands of miles long, that forms above a subduction zone. An island volcanic arc forms in an ocean basin via ocean-ocean subduction. The Aleutian Islands off the coast of Alaska and the Lesser Antilles south of Puerto Rico are examples.
